Understanding Screen Readers and Their Functionality

A screen reader is essentially a software application that acts as an interpreter between the visual elements displayed on a computer screen and the user. It intercepts the content displayed by the operating system and presents it in an alternative format, primarily audio speech or tactile Braille. This enables users to “read” web pages, interact with controls, and understand the layout of a website without relying on their vision.

The core functionality of a screen reader revolves around several key operations. First, it reads the text content, including paragraphs, headings, and lists. It identifies and vocalizes the textual information, allowing the user to comprehend the content of a web page. Second, a screen reader facilitates navigation. It identifies and announces headings, links, form fields, and other interactive elements, enabling the user to move through the content efficiently. Users can use keyboard shortcuts to jump between sections, activate links, or fill out forms. Third, a screen reader interacts with interactive components. This includes buttons, checkboxes, radio buttons, and other form controls. The user can activate these elements using keyboard commands and receive feedback in the form of speech or Braille output. This interactive capability ensures that users can fully engage with online applications and services. Understanding how screen readers function is crucial to understanding how to successfully browse with Chrome.

Common screen readers include JAWS (Job Access With Speech), NVDA (NonVisual Desktop Access), and VoiceOver (Apple’s built-in screen reader). While the specific features and commands may vary between screen readers, the underlying principle remains the same: to convert visual information into an accessible format, empowering users to access and interact with the digital world.

Configuring Your Setup to Use Screen Readers with Chrome

Getting started with a screen reader in Google Chrome involves a few setup steps, which vary depending on the chosen screen reader. Let’s look at the common set-up steps for two widely-used screen readers: NVDA (NonVisual Desktop Access) and JAWS.

NVDA

Download and install NVDA from the official website (nvaccess.org). During installation, choose your desired voice and settings. Once NVDA is installed, open Chrome. Ensure NVDA is running, and the speech output is active. Chrome should automatically recognize and interact with NVDA. You can verify this by navigating the Chrome interface using the keyboard (Tab, Shift+Tab).

JAWS

JAWS is a commercial screen reader, so you’ll need to purchase a license. After installing JAWS, ensure it’s running. Similar to NVDA, Chrome should automatically integrate with JAWS. To verify, try using keyboard shortcuts like Tab to move through links and elements in Chrome. You might need to adjust JAWS settings within JAWS itself to optimize its interaction with Chrome (e.g., setting focus mode, verbosity levels).

After installing your screen reader, you may need to adjust its settings to optimize the browsing experience in Chrome. This might involve customizing voice settings, adjusting the level of detail the screen reader provides, or configuring keyboard shortcuts.

Navigating the Web Effectively with a Screen Reader in Chrome

Once your screen reader is set up and ready to go, learning basic navigation techniques is key to successful browsing in Chrome. These techniques, combined with the screen reader, will make the user’s digital experience easier.

Basic Keyboard Shortcuts

A few basic keyboard shortcuts form the foundation of web navigation. The Tab key is essential, allowing you to move forward through links, form fields, and interactive elements on a web page. Shift+Tab moves backward. Use the arrow keys to read content line by line or character by character, if your screen reader is configured to do so. The Enter key activates a selected link or button. These simple shortcuts are all useful in using a screen reader with Chrome.

Reading and Interacting with Content

With the core shortcuts mastered, you can start to read and interact with content. The specific commands for reading content vary depending on the screen reader. For example, in NVDA, pressing the “Down Arrow” will begin reading from the current point. Many screen readers offer commands to read entire lines, paragraphs, or the entire document. To interact with form fields, use the Tab key to navigate to the field and begin typing. Activating buttons is usually done with the Enter key or Spacebar.

Advanced Navigation

Several advanced navigation techniques can greatly improve your efficiency. Web pages often use headings to organize content. Most screen readers provide shortcut keys (like the “H” key in JAWS or NVDA) to jump directly to headings, allowing you to skip through content and find what you’re looking for quickly. If a website uses well-structured landmarks (such as navigation menus, main content areas, and footers), your screen reader might have a feature to jump to these landmarks as well.

Addressing Common Web Accessibility Challenges: Unfortunately, not all websites are created equal in terms of accessibility. You might encounter issues like missing alt text (descriptions for images), poorly-labeled form fields, or content that’s not properly structured. When these issues arise, the screen reader may not be able to convey the information clearly or at all. If you have an issue, you should note this.
